Another area of #climateadaptation investments. #wildfireprevention. The Climate Adaptation Project will post one startup each week as an example of the areas and solutions that are already investable in this blind spot of climate tech investments. Richard Delevan Ivonne Briceño Albert Bielinko
#globalwarming did lead to a massively increased risk of #wildfires. Wildfire detection and monitoring from space. This is what OroraTech does. The sooner we understand the development and spread of wildfires, the better we can prepare and fight against them. Ananda Impact Ventures, a Munich-based impact investor, showed courage to invest early. This #EarthMonth we are spotlighting trailblazing funds and fund managers that are driving a more inclusive energy transition. Brahm Rhodes, Juliana Garaizar, and Kerry Bowie, co-GPs of Malaika Ventures, invest in extraordinary founders using a climate justice lens to achieve a rapid and just energy transition. The #vc firm operates at the intersection of climate, innovation, and inclusion. The team blends deep experience and networks in climate, technology, accelerators, and early-stage investing to open doors for founders. Several years ago, Bowie founded Browning the Green Space, a coalition committed to advancing #dei in clean energy. The group found a home for their meetings at Greentown Labs in Somerville, MA, which Garaizar was connected to as she was working to launch the organization’s Houston incubator. Rhodes was a coach for Bowie's Majira Project, a nonprofit accelerator program. 🌏 “The climate transition is the biggest risk and opportunity facing the global capital markets in our generation.” Unwritten helps investors quantify the impact of climate events to their portfolio. Built by ex-Palantir data scientists Amos Wittenberg and Phillip Marks, Ph.D. in our Aviva Venture Studio, Unwritten uses data analytics to model complex interactions between regions, sectors, policies, and technologies, and translate these into financial data. Unwritten has just raised a $3.5M seed round led by Connect Ventures, with investment from Planet A Ventures, Sand River, and Adapt Nation Capital.
